All-CMOS Monitor circuits in a 3-lead SOT-23 package offer the
best performance in power consumption and accuracy.
The ILC5061 comes in a series of ±1% accurate trip voltages to
fit most microprocessor applications. Even though its output
can sink 2mA, the device draws only 1µA in normal operation.
Additionally, a built-in hysteresis of 5% of detect voltage
simplifies system design.

• All-CMOS design in SOT-23 and SOT-89 package
• ±1% precision in Reset Detection
• Only 1µA of Iq
• 2mA of sink current capability
• Built-in hysteresis of 5% of detection voltage
• Voltage options of 2.6, 2.9, 3.1, 4.4, and 4.6V fit most
• Microprocessor reset circuits
• Memory battery back-up circuitry
• Power-on reset circuits
• Portable and battery powered electronics
